SIL または PIL でソースレベル デバッグを有効にする
SIL または PIL 実行時の生成コードのデバッグ
R2023a 以降
説明
アプリ構成ペイン: デバッグ
構成オブジェクト: coder.EmbeddedCodeConfig
ソフトウェアインザループ (SIL) またはプロセッサインザループ (PIL) 実行時の生成コードのデバッグ。
SIL または PIL の実行中における生成コードのデバッグ (Embedded Coder)を参照してください。
設定
- オフ
この値が既定値です。
SIL または PIL 実行時の生成コードのデバッグを無効にします。
- オン
ソフトウェアインザループ (SIL) またはプロセッサインザループ (PIL) 実行時のデバッガーによるコードの動作の観察を有効にします。
SIL の実行でサポートされるデバッガー:
Windows® では、次の手順を実行します。
Microsoft® Visual Studio® IDE。
Visual Studio Code と MinGW® GDB。MATLAB® Coder™ Interface for Visual Studio Code Debugging サポート パッケージのインストールが必要です。
macOS では、Visual Studio Code と LLDB。MATLAB Coder Interface for Visual Studio Code Debugging サポート パッケージのインストールが必要です。
Linux® では、次のようにします。
GNU® Data Display Debugger (DDD)。
Visual Studio Code と GDB。MATLAB Coder Interface for Visual Studio Code Debugging サポート パッケージのインストールが必要です。
サポート パッケージのインストールの詳細については、https://www.mathworks.com/matlabcentral/fileexchange/103555-matlab-coder-interface-for-visual-studio-code-debuggingを参照してください。
PIL 実行用のデバッガーのセットアップの詳細については、Set Up PIL Connectivity by Using Target Framework (Embedded Coder)を参照してください。
プログラムでの使用
プロパティ: SILPILDebugging |
値: false | true |
既定の設定: false |
バージョン履歴
R2023a で導入